YOUNGSTOWN, Ohio – Northern Kentucky women's tennis fell to Horizon League-leading Youngstown State on Saturday afternoon by a final score of 5-2. The Norse drop to 6-8 overall and 3-3 in League play while the Penguins remain undefeated in the Horizon League at 6-0 and 12-9 overall.
Match Notables
- The Penguins took the doubles point with wins in No. 2 and 3 doubles, and the rattled off wins in the No. 3, 5 and 4 singles matches to clinch the team win.
- Margita Sunjic kept her League record unblemished and recorded her sixth-consecutive straight-set win with a 7-6, 6-4 victory over Noelly Longi Nsimba in the top flight. The match was Longi Nsimba's first loss in League play.
- Katja Dijanezevic added a three-set win in No. 6 singles, taking down Cassandra Moraleja, 6-2, 5-7, 10-8.
- Despite the setbacks, the Norse gave superb efforts with extended sets in three of the four singles losses.
- Maria Koo and Sydney Power both fought back from a 6-2 opening set to extend their second sets, eventually falling 7-5. Koo dropped the No. 2 match to Sofia Macias, while Power fell to Anastasiia Khokhlova in No. 3 singles.
- Taylor Culbertson had a similar effort, falling 6-1, 7-5 to Imaan Hassim in the No. 4 slot.
